Kudhal - Doiwala, Dehradun
Kudhal is a village situated in the Doiwala tehsil of Dehradun district, Uttarakhand. It is located approximately 16 km from Rishikesh and around 20 km from Dehradun. Kudiyal serves as the Gram Panchayat for Kudhal village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Kudhal is 045303. The village covers a total geographical area of 49.62 hectares and falls under the 248001 pincode. Rishikesh is the nearest town, located about 16 km away.
Kudhal village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Doiwala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Hardwar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Kudhal
As per Census 2011, Kudhal village has a total population of 441 people, consisting of 228 males and 213 females. The village has 84 households and a sex ratio of 934 females per 1,000 males. There are 62 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 342 literate and 99 illiterate residents. Additionally, 6 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Kudhal are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 441 | 228 | 213 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 62 | 34 | 28 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 6 | 3 | 3 |
| Literate Population | 342 | 188 | 154 |
| Illiterate Population | 99 | 40 | 59 |

Transport and Connectivity of Kudhal
Kudhal is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within 1-2 km of the village. The nearest railway station is located within >10 km of Kudhal.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Private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Railway Station | No | Available within >10 km |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Rishikesh to Kudhal is about 16 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Dehradun to Kudhal is about 20 km, with the usual travel time around 30-60 minutes.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
Banking and Postal Services in Kudhal
Banking and postal services are essential for daily financial transactions and communication. The availability of these facilities for Kudhal village is detailed below:
| Service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Bank | No | Available within 1-2 km |
| ATM | No | Available within 1-2 km |
| Post Office | No | Available within 2-5 km |
Health Facilities in Kudhal
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Kudhal village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| No | Available within 2-5 km |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| No | Available within 1-2 km |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| No | Available within >10 km |
